>> FC10, How do I select the kernel I want to boot from, at boot start,
>> esc, tab, What ??
>>     
> Here's what I do:
>
>
> 1) edit /boot/grub/grub.conf
> change "timeout=0" to "timeout=20"
> Comment out the "hiddenmenu" line
>
> 2) save the above changes
>
> reboot - now you should see the kernels to choose from on the startup screen
